Grilling set
The grilling set includes the roasting pan grid
and the deep roasting pan. You can use the
roasting pan grid on the two sides.
Warning! Risk of burns when removing
the accessories from a hot oven.
You can use the grill-
ing set to roast larger
pieces of meat or
poultry on one level:
Put the roasting pan
grid inside the deep
roasting pan so that
the supports of the
oven shelf point up-
wards.
You can use the grill-
ing set to grill flat
dishes in large quan-
tities and to toast:
Put the roasting pan
grid inside the deep
roasting pan so that
the supports of the
oven shelf point
downwards.
Put the deep roasting pan in the oven at the
necessary level.
Only put the grilling set on the second or
third shelf level of top oven.
Oven - Helpful hints and tips
Warning! Refer to the Safety chapters.
The temperature and baking times in the
tables are guidelines only. They depend on
the recipes, quality and quantity of the ingredi-
ents used.
Top oven
The top oven is the smaller of the two ovens. It
has 3 shelf levels. Use is to cook smaller quan-
tities of food. It gives especially good results
when used to cook fruitcakes, sweets and sa-
voury flants or quiche.
Main oven
The main oven is particularly suitable for cook-
ing larger quantities of food.
Baking
General instructions
Your new oven may bake or roast differently
to the appliance you had before. Adapt your
usual settings (temperature, cooking times)
and shelf levels to the values in the tables.
With longer baking times, the oven can be
switched off about 10 minutes before the
end of baking time, to use the residual heat.
Use deep roasting pan in middle or top shelf
level of top oven.
To brown pastry dishes on the bottom, cook
on metal plate or put on a baking tray.
When you use frozen food, the trays in
the oven can twist during baking. When
the trays get cold again, the distortion
will be gone.
How to use the Baking Tables
We recommend to use the lower tempera-
ture the first time.
If you cannot find the settings for a special
recipe, look for the one that is almost the
same.
